confesarConjugation
confesar means to confess.
Complete Conjugation Tables
Reference all tenses and moods
Indicative
Present
Confesar has a stem change (e > ie) in all forms except nosotros and vosotros: confieso, confiesas, confiesa, confesamos, confesáis, confiesan.
Future
The future tense is regular: confesaré, confesarás, confesará, confesaremos, confesaréis, confesarán.
Imperfect
The imperfect of confesar is regular: confesaba, confesabas, confesaba, confesábamos, confesabais, confesaban.
Conditional
The conditional is regular: confesaría, confesarías, confesaría, confesaríamos, confesaríais, confesarían.
Preterite
The preterite of confesar is regular: confesé, confesaste, confesó, confesamos, confesasteis, confesaron.
Imperative
Negative Imperative
The negative imperative uses the present subjunctive forms: no confieses, no confiese, no confesemos, no confeséis, no confiesen.
Imperative
The affirmative imperative uses the 'ie' stem change for most forms: confiesa (tú), confiese (usted), confesad (vosotros).
Subjunctive
Present Subjunctive
The present subjunctive mirrors the present indicative stem change: confiese, confieses, confiese, confesemos, confeséis, confiesen.
Imperfect Subjunctive
The imperfect subjunctive is formed from the preterite stem: confesara, confesaras, confesara, confesáramos, confesarais, confesaran.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does confesar mean in Spanish?
confesar means "to confess".
Is confesar a regular or irregular verb?
confesar is a irregular (stem-changing: e>ie) -ar verb in Spanish.
How do you conjugate confesar in the present tense?
The present tense of confesar is: yo confieso, tú confiesas, él/ella/usted confiesa, nosotros confesamos, vosotros confesáis, ellos/ellas/ustedes confiesan.
How do you conjugate confesar in the preterite (past tense)?
The preterite of confesar is: yo confesé, tú confesaste, él/ella/usted confesó, nosotros confesamos, vosotros confesasteis, ellos/ellas/ustedes confesaron.
